PP飞桨的“借壳部署”技能
发布网友
发布时间:2024-09-26 15:21
我来回答
共1个回答
热心网友
时间:2024-09-29 15:27
飞桨的强大助手PaddleHub闪亮登场!
PaddleHub是飞桨生态中的一款预训练模型应用工具,它为开发者提供了便利,通过Fine-tune API,可以轻松地整合高质量预训练模型,完成模型从训练到部署的全流程。覆盖的模型范围广泛,包括图像分类、目标检测、文本分析(词法、语义、情感)、视频分类、图像生成、图像分割、文本审核、关键点检测等常用领域。
对于如何安装PaddlePaddle环境,建议参考我的另一篇文章。确保安装最新版本,成功安装后,可以通过hub命令行工具开始部署。
PaddleHub Serving作为一键模型服务部署工具,通过命令行工具轻松启动模型预测服务,前端通过Flask和Gunicorn处理网络请求,后端调用预测接口,支持多进程并发,提升服务性能。它适用于部署PaddleHub的众多可预测模型,未来还将支持Fine-tune API自定义模型部署。
部署服务端有两种方式,这里主要介绍命令行启动,配置文件部署方式请参阅相关链接。以启动中文OCR翻译服务为例,部署完成后,服务默认运行在8866端口。
为了实现文字识别,可能需要组合使用chinese_text_detection_db_mobile和chinese_ocr_db_crnn_mobile模块,自行训练数据集并生成inference_module。具体步骤包括训练、导出和替换模型。在Aistudio或本地GPU上训练PaddleOCR,然后将定制的inference_module放入特定目录。
经过这样的“借壳”操作,模型部署效率提升显著,只需稍加修改即可运行自己的inference_module。细节问题欢迎留言交流。最后,感谢飞桨PaddlePaddle团队的辛勤付出。
PP飞桨的“借壳部署”技能
经过这样的“借壳”操作,模型部署效率提升显著,只需稍加修改即可运行自己的inference_module。细节问题欢迎留言交流。最后,感谢飞桨PaddlePaddle团队的辛勤付出。